I use Ubuntu 64bit 19.04. I use python 3.7.5
I installed the TA-LIB libraries from ta-lib-0.4.0-src.tar.gz successfully.
However when i call python setup.py install i get that error:
running install
running build
running build_py
running build_ext
Traceback (most recent call last):
File "setup.py", line 170, in
**requires)
File "/usr/lib/python3.7/distutils/core.py", line 148, in setup
dist.run_commands()
File "/usr/lib/python3.7/distutils/dist.py", line 966, in run_commands
self.run_command(cmd)
File "/usr/lib/python3.7/distutils/dist.py", line 985, in run_command
cmd_obj.run()
File "/usr/lib/python3.7/distutils/command/install.py", line 589, in run
self.run_command('build')
File "/usr/lib/python3.7/distutils/cmd.py", line 313, in run_command
self.distribution.run_command(command)
File "/usr/lib/python3.7/distutils/dist.py", line 985, in run_command
cmd_obj.run()
File "/usr/lib/python3.7/distutils/command/build.py", line 135, in run
self.run_command(cmd_name)
File "/usr/lib/python3.7/distutils/cmd.py", line 313, in run_command
self.distribution.run_command(command)
File "/usr/lib/python3.7/distutils/dist.py", line 983, in run_command
cmd_obj = self.get_command_obj(command)
File "/usr/lib/python3.7/distutils/dist.py", line 857, in get_command_obj
klass = self.get_command_class(command)
File "/usr/lib/python3.7/distutils/dist.py", line 840, in get_command_class
self.cmdclass[command] = klass
File "setup.py", line 86, in setitem
raise AssertionError("build_ext overridden!")
AssertionError: build_ext overridden!
What should i do?
I'm not sure what is different about your distutils that seems to be overriding the build_ext that is provided in the setup.py... that does not happen with my Python3 installations.
Any resolution to this? I have the same issue.
Can you provide some information about your environment? What version of python, cython, numpy, distutils, setuputils?
same issue on aarch64 AWS serve. Python 3.7.3